Join Spirax Group
Spirax Group, a FTSE100 engineering business renowned for its collaborative culture, commitment to sustainability and exceptional track record of developing its people, invites you to join as a Senior Finance Business Partner. In this role, you'll provide strategic financial leadership across several global functions, partnering with senior stakeholders to shape investment decisions, drive performance and influence long-term business strategy.
Client Details
Spirax Group is a FTSE100 global engineering business with a purpose of creating a more efficient, safer and sustainable world. Operating in more than 165 countries, the Group's technologies support critical industrial processes across sectors including food & beverage, pharmaceuticals, healthcare, energy and manufacturing.
Recognised for its engineering excellence, collaborative culture and commitment to sustainability, Spirax is equally well known for investing in its people. The business has a strong track record of developing talent, offering long-term career opportunities and creating an environment where individuals are encouraged to grow, challenge themselves and make a genuine impact.
Description
Financial Planning & Analysis
- Lead budgeting, forecasting and long-range planning across multiple global business areas, ensuring robust financial planning aligned to divisional strategy.
- Own performance reporting, providing insightful variance analysis, commercial challenge and recommendations to support strategic decision-making.
- Drive investment planning, capital forecasting, business case governance and cost optimisation across the portfolio.
- Oversee weekly sales forecasts, monthly management reporting, balance sheet forecasting and KPI reporting, continuously improving reporting quality and processes.
- Support Group Tax with annual R&D claims and coordinate budget consolidation across global business areas.
- Develop and enhance FP&A processes, reporting tools and financial insight to improve business performance.

Financial Modelling & Projects
- Develop and maintain financial models supporting strategic planning, investment decisions, scenario modelling and business cases.
- Oversee financial tracking of capital and operational projects, ensuring robust reporting, governance and budget control.
Business Partnering & Stakeholder Management
- Partner with senior operational leaders, providing commercial insight, financial challenge and decision support across Innovation, Digital, Sustainability and other global functions.
- Build strong relationships across Finance, Legal, Tax, Supply and Sales to support cross-functional initiatives.
- Prepare and present financial analysis and recommendations to senior leadership, supporting investment decisions and strategic priorities.
- Support royalty, recharge and intercompany processes, ensuring robust governance and consistent financial reporting across the Group.
- Work closely with Financial Reporting teams to ensure accurate, timely and policy-compliant management reporting.
Leadership
- Lead, coach and develop a team of four Management Accountants, driving performance, succession planning and professional development.

Projects
- Support the wider Finance Leadership Team on strategic projects, business initiatives and audit requirements as required.
Profile
- Qualified accountant (ACA, ACCA or CIMA) with significant post-qualified commercial finance experience.
- Strong FP&A, financial planning, forecasting and performance analysis capability within a multinational environment.
- Advanced Excel, financial modelling and experience using ERP/accounting systems.
- Highly analytical, with the ability to interpret complex financial data and deliver actionable commercial insight.
- Excellent communication, presentation and stakeholder management skills, with the confidence to influence senior leaders.
- Commercially minded, with strong business acumen and the ability to support strategic decision-making.
- Proven problem-solving skills, adaptable to changing business priorities and environments.
- Experience leading, collaborating and building relationships across cross-functional teams.
- High levels of integrity, attention to detail and understanding of financial governance and regulatory compliance.
Job Offer
In addition to an excellent base salary, you will receive a company car allowance (circa £9k), a discretionary bonus, flexible working and excellent benefits including 27 days holiday allowance (before bank holidays), 3 days' paid volunteering leave, comprehensive private healthcare, enhanced pension plan, life assurance, optional participation in a Share Ownership Plan, free onsite parking, flexible benefits, and access to a personal discounts' portal.
